In order to be approved for shifts via Bookamed, you are required to submit all of the mandatory documents. Mandatory documents are used to determine your legal right to live and work in the country, as well as for the NHS.
The mandatory documents are;
- Proof of identity – e.g. Passport, Driver’s License
- Proof of address – e.g. Passport, Driver’s License
- Health authority certification
- Right to work – e.g. Passport, work VISA, biometric residence card
- Medical indemnity certificate – This document insures you in the event you carry out medical work or assistance that is unrelated to your role. It can be during or outside your shift hours, and it covers you in the event that something goes wrong.
- Curriculum Vitae – A document containing your contact details, residential address, employment history, key skills and your referees.
- Enhanced DBS check certificate – This document displays your criminal record, including fines, arrests, warrants and warnings.
